Guaranteeing safety is the leading priority in the commercial arena, and a Commercial Electrician acts as the main guardian versus concealed electrical dangers. In Sydney's busy business districts, a Commercial Electrician should follow strict testing procedures to verify that every system complies with the highest safety requirements. This includes conducting regular switchboard thermography to identify possible flaws before they aggravate, together with compulsory residual existing gadget inspections to shield staff from injury. The mindful precision a Commercial Electrician brings represents a financial investment in danger decrease, avoiding the extreme downtime that can stem from electrical fires or rises. As commercial settings continually progress, a Commercial Electrician delivers the continuous preventive maintenance needed to satisfy shifting load needs. By protecting a safe, code‑compliant electrical facilities, a Commercial Electrician protects both a business's physical properties and check here the lives of its workers.
